Even though there will be a lot of us running, it is okay if someone may have to walk and then pick it back up. One thing people think when they just start out is that they have to keep up and run the whole time even if they are by themselves. That is when people get discouraged and think they are a failure and will never be able to run. The truth is you CAN always go at your own pace. When you are just starting out with running, it is so easy to want to quit. You have to think, say you just joined the gym and you want to try Zumba so bad, but you think you will never keep up. One day you try it and love it. So you keep going and each time you go you get better and can last longer. The same thing is with running - you have to start and keep going and you will get better with time. Our minds and thoughts will have us thinking all sorts of things to tell us that we cant do something. But I am going to tell you that you CAN do anything that you set out to do. It may not always be easy, but it is always possible. Run/walk intervals are the best way to start. How I set myself up for success?? Make a plan to eat healthy and prep everything. Before you start a new week, you should have a meal plan and shop for groceries according to that. (I didnt have my meal plan ready before we went) When you are done, there should be no whole veggies and fruits left- like cucumbers, celery and such. Cut everything and put small portions in small containers or mini sandwhich bags, so you can grab and go. even sandwhich meat - separate the portions according to serving size and put in mini bags!
